Thursday, 3 May 2012

PM Receives CIS Observer Mission Delegation

Prime Minister Tigran Sargsyan received a delegation led by head of CIS observer mission for Armenia’s May 6 parliamentary election, Deputy Chairman of CIS Executive Committee Vladimir Garkun. Thanking the Prime Minister for invitation, Mr. Garkun said the mission comprises 173 observers and gave the details of the nationwide monitoring carried out since April 16. The head of CIS observer mission highlighted the smooth pace of electoral campaign, with equal conditions offered to... more »

Friday, 30 December 2011

All Welfare Payments Increased

The Cabinet met in their last sitting of 2011, chaired by Prime Minister Tigran Sargsyan. Pursuant to amended government decree, base pension rate will be up about 24% as of January 1, 2012, from AMD 10,500 to AMD 13 thousand. The average retirement pension will be 31,300 dram instead of 28, 700 (9 percent growth), welfare pensions will average 16, 500 instead of 13, 200 dram (about 20 percent growth), the average rate of disability pensions for rank-and-file servicemen will rise to about... more »
